I hit up the local dyno day on sunday..can't beat 20bucks for 3pulls. I was only going for 300hp..did some math on my old dyno runs last year. Exhaust setup changed, and fuel setup changed slightly. Still stock engine/cams...may just got get some s13 cams for now or save up and get some JWT/Kelford possibly. I just daily 9psi though Although 2 full spare ka's sit in my garage. The dirty car
